Shymala Gowri S is a researcher in biomedical engineering and human-machine interaction, with a focus on assistive technologies and gesture-based control systems. Her most cited work, "Gesture Controlled Prosthetic Arm" (2017), introduces a novel, low-cost accelerometer-based system for wirelessly controlling prosthetic limbs through hand gestures. This research replaces conventional control mechanisms with an innovative gesture identification algorithm, offering a more intuitive and affordable solution for amputees. With 4 citations, this paper has laid foundational work for accessible prosthetic design.
